Classification of bacteria: difficult to classify: mode of nutrition how they metabolize resources, ability to produce. Resistant bodies that contain dna & small amount of cytoplasm surrounded by. Flagella = apical/posterior/engulf cell or corkscrew motion or gliding through. Cocci - spherical / bacilli - rod-shaped / spirilla-spirochetes - spirals: shapes, thick peptidoglycan wall cell = gram-(+) thin peptidoglycan covered w/lipopolysaccharides = gram (-) Photosynthetic like plants use chlorophyll a/split water/release o2/etc. Some have specialized heterocysts cells that produce nitrogen-fixing enzyme. = converts fixed inorganic nitrogen gas into nh3 used to make amino acids & Nucleotides *ex: blue-green algae-not related to other prokaryotic algae groups. Autotrophs = some nitrifying bacteria no2- no3- Heterotrophs = fix n2 & lives in nodules of plant *mutualism. C- domain eukarya - 4 kingdoms pafp & *subcategories =phylum. Artificial kingdom used mainly for convenience/poorly understood - mostly unicellular.
